“Evidence Shows Otherwise” – Family Demands Investigation is Reopened into Son’s Alleged Suicide

November 18 2021 Manhattan, New York – Mother, family and protesters gathered in Harlem to demand investigation into the death of Antonio Armstrong.

Armstrong’s death was ruled a suicide, but family believes otherwise, pointing to evidence they observed.

Police say Armstrong was found dead inside a Harlem apartment at 135th & Adam Clayton Powell, on October 6th 2021, after police say he shot at NYPD officers and barricaded himself inside.

Video by Kevin RC Wilson (FNTV Freedomnews.tv)

Leave a Reply

This site uses Akismet to reduce spam. Learn how your comment data is processed.

GIPHY App Key not set. Please check settings

Man DETAINED With Gun Outside Kenosha Court House at #RittenhouseTrial

Two People Dead, Child Critically Injured After Heavy Fire in Harlem Overnight